Action failed for assembly 'AutoSubmitOrder, Version=1.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=6b240a09e4448ad7': Assembly must be registered in isolation.
The User which were used to import the Solution was missing Deployment Administrator Role, So Deployment administrator role is the king of Global admin in On-Premise Environment
As per Microsoft Post: Click Here
Deployment Administrators have unrestricted access to perform Deployment Manager tasks on all organizations and servers in a Dynamics 365 for Customer Engagement deployment.

]]>For 2015 & 2016 & D365 use the v2.5.0.0 release
For 2011 & 2013 use the v1.5.0.0 release
1) CRM Rest Builder GIT Hub URL
2) CRM Rest Builder Drive v2.5.0.0 , v1.5.0.0
And follow the below steps
Step 1 – Navigate to your Organisation Settings -> Solutions and click on Import Button
Step 2 – Click on to Browse Button
Step 3 – Navigate to the solution file previously downloaded and click on open and then click on Next
Step 4 – Click on to Import Button
Step 5 – After some time you will see the below success message
Step 6 – Now you will be able to see the CRM Rest Builder Button on the ribbon bar on solutions Click on it
And You are good to go with CRM Rest Builder
